Understanding Rug Pulls and DeFi Fraud
A rug pull signifies a malicious act where project developers abruptly abandon a token, siphoning off all invested capital from its liquidity pool, rendering presale tokens or newly launched assets worthless. This exit scam is a prevalent DeFi fraud, characterized by a sudden liquidity drain, often occurring shortly after a promising token launch. Another deceptive tactic is the honeypot, where users can buy but are prevented from selling. Recognizing these patterns instantly is crucial, highlighting where the speed of bot trading strategies might offer a unique, albeit risky, advantage for investor protection.
The Speed Advantage of Sniper Bots
Sniper bots are specialized software programs engineered for ultra-fast transaction execution, often within milliseconds of a token launch or significant blockchain event. Traditionally, these automated trading tools functioned as front-running bots, aiming to purchase tokens just before others to profit from immediate price spikes. Their unparalleled speed, far exceeding human reaction, is their defining characteristic. While their use often sparks debate regarding market fairness, this very attribute can be theoretically adapted not just for aggressive entry, but more importantly, for rapid exit, which is key to minimizing exposure to an impending crypto scam.
Repurposing Bots for Rapid Exit and Mitigation
The utility of sniper bots in “avoiding” rug pulls isn’t about prevention, but about significantly reducing financial exposure through accelerated reaction. Instead of merely seeking profit from a token launch, a bot can be programmed with sophisticated scam detection parameters. Should these pre-defined red flags manifest immediately after an investment in presale tokens, the bot could automatically trigger a sell order. This allows for an attempt to offload assets before a complete liquidity drain or exit scam solidifies. This proactive risk management strategy, however, demands meticulous configuration and understanding of bot trading strategies.
Bot Trading Strategies for Early Warning
- Liquidity Pool Monitoring: A key bot trading strategy involves continuous real-time monitoring of the project’s liquidity pool. A sudden, unexplained drop in liquidity immediately after a token launch, without corresponding legitimate trading volume, is a critical indicator of an imminent liquidity drain or exit scam. The bot can be configured to execute a sell order if liquidity falls below a set threshold.
- Smart Contract Security Checks: While not a full audit, advanced sniper bots can perform rapid, automated checks on smart contract security. They might scan for common vulnerabilities, such as functions allowing developers to mint infinite tokens (dilution risk) or owner-only sell functions, typical of a honeypot. These quick scans offer an initial layer of scam detection.
- Developer Wallet Tracking: Monitoring significant outgoing transactions from developer or team wallets shortly after a token launch can be a strong signal of an impending exit scam. A bot can be programmed to alert the user or even trigger an automated sell if such suspicious activity is detected, providing crucial investor protection.
- Automated Stop-Loss Mechanisms: Implementing aggressive stop-loss orders allows the bot to exit a position rapidly if the token’s price plummets, regardless of whether it’s a rug pull or another market event. This form of risk management limits potential losses significantly.
Inherent Risks and Limitations
Despite their potential, relying on sniper bots for investor protection against rug pulls carries substantial risks:
- Technical Expertise Required: Effective configuration of bot trading strategies for scam detection demands deep technical knowledge of blockchain mechanics and smart contract security.
- Gas Wars and High Fees: Competing with other automated trading front-running bots during a high-demand token launch can lead to exorbitant gas fees, negating profits or increasing losses.
- False Alarms: Overly sensitive scam detection parameters might trigger premature exits from legitimate projects, leading to missed opportunities.
- Ethical and Legal Ambiguity: The use of front-running bots and certain bot trading strategies can blur the lines into market manipulation, posing ethical and potentially legal challenges.
- Bot Vulnerabilities: The bots themselves are software and prone to bugs, exploits, or misconfigurations that can lead to unintended trades or security breaches.
Holistic Investor Protection Beyond Automation
Ultimately, sniper bots are a specialized tool, not a complete solution for investor protection against DeFi fraud. Comprehensive risk management must always integrate traditional scam detection methods:
- Thorough Due Diligence: Rigorous research into the project team, whitepaper, tokenomics, and community sentiment is crucial before engaging with presale tokens or a token launch.
- Smart Contract Audits: Verify that smart contract security has been independently audited by reputable firms.
- Liquidity Locking: Confirm that project liquidity is locked for a significant period to prevent immediate liquidity drain.
- Transparency: Prioritize projects with transparent teams and clear development roadmaps to avoid an exit scam.
